How to Use Windows 11 as a Bluetooth Audio Receiver: 5 Steps to Do It! 🎧

To use your Windows 11 PC as a Bluetooth speaker, go to Settings > Bluetooth, turn on Bluetooth 🔵, click Add device ➕, and pair your device. Download and install the Bluetooth Audio Receiver app from the Microsoft Store 🛒. Open the app, select your device, and click Open connection 🔗. Open a music app 🎵 on your device and start playing.

Did you know you can use your Windows 11 PC as a Bluetooth speaker? 🎧 This lets you listen to your favorite songs from your devices, like an iPhone 📱 or Android 🤖, right on your computer 💻. I'll show you how to set it up! 🔥

Step 1: Pair Your Bluetooth Device with Your PC

To listen to music on your Windows 11 PC from a Bluetooth device, you'll first need to pair that device with your PC. This is how your PC recognizes your device. 🤝

To do this, turn on Bluetooth on your device, such as your iPhone or Android phone. On an iPhone, go to Settings > Bluetooth and turn on the "Bluetooth" switch. On an Android phone, swipe down twice from the top of the screen and tap the "Bluetooth" icon. 📱

In Windows 11, open Settings by pressing Windows+i. In the left sidebar, select "Bluetooth & devices." In the right pane, turn on "Bluetooth" if it isn't already enabled. Then, next to Devices, click "Add device."
"Bluetooth & Devices," "Bluetooth," and "Add Device" highlighted in Windows 11 Settings.

In the "Add Device" window, select "Bluetooth." Wait for your PC to detect your device. When your device appears in the list, click it to select it.
"Bluetooth" highlighted on the "'Add a Device" window.

When your PC says "Your device is ready to use!", click "Done" to close the window. Your PC and device are now paired. 🎉
"Done" highlighted in the "Add a Device" window.

Step 2: Use a Free App to Receive Bluetooth Audio on Your PC

To receive audio via Bluetooth on your Windows 11 PC, you will need to Download Bluetooth Audio Receiver from the Microsoft StoreThis is because Windows 11 doesn't have a built-in feature that allows it to act as a Bluetooth speaker. 📲

To get that app, open Windows Search (press Windows+S), type Microsoft Store and open the app. Click the search box at the top, type Bluetooth Audio Receiver, press Enter and select the app from the list. Then, choose "Get" to download and install the app. 🚀

Open Windows Search again, type Bluetooth Audio Receiver and select the app from the search results. On the app screen, select the device you want to receive audio from. This should be the device you paired with your PC earlier. After selecting the device, click the "Open Connection" button. 🔥
A Bluetooth device and "Open Connection" highlighted in Bluetooth Audio Receiver.

At the top of the device list, you'll see a message that says [Your device name] Connected, indicating that your PC is ready to act as a Bluetooth speaker for your device. 🥳
"[Device Name] Connected" highlighted in Bluetooth Audio Receiver.

On your device, open a music app and start playing audio. You'll see the audio playing through your PC's speakers. You can control the volume using your device's volume control or by clicking the sound icon in your PC's system tray and adjusting the volume level. 🎤

When you want to stop listening to music on your PC, open the Bluetooth Audio Receiver window and click the "Close Connection" button. Note that it's not necessary to unpair your device. 😉

Troubleshooting Problems When Using Your PC as a Bluetooth Speaker

If you're having trouble connecting or playing music on your Windows 11 PC, the following troubleshooting tips should help you resolve the issue. ⚙️

If Your PC Can't Find Your Bluetooth Device

If you don't see your Bluetooth device in the "Add a Device" window on your computer, it's likely that your device isn't discoverable. In this case, access the pairing screen on your device. 🛠️

For example, on an Android phone, you would go to Settings > Connected Devices > Pair New Device and keep this screen open while you go through the pairing process on your PC. 📜

If There Is No Audio Output on Your PC

If the connection is established, but your PC doesn't play audio, make sure you haven't muted your PC speakers. To check this, click the sound icon in your PC's system tray and increases the volume. 🔈

If you're using headphones with your PC, right-click the sound icon and select "Sound settings." In the window that opens, click "Choose where to play sound" and select your headphones. This ensures your PC routes the audio to the correct output device. 🎧
"Choose where to play sound" highlighted in Windows 11 settings.

If Audio Interrupts

If your audio is interrupted, make sure both your PC and device are close to each other. This is because Bluetooth has a functional range of 30 feet (10 meters). Outside of that range, your devices can't communicate. Also, make sure there are no obstacles between your PC and your device. 📏


And that's how you use your computer speakers as speakers Bluetooth on Windows 11. With this, you can also play audio from multiple outputs in Windows 11. 🎉
